WebAug 17, 2024 · The atom consists of discrete particles that govern its chemical and physical behavior. Each atom of an element contains the same number of protons, which is the atomic number ( Z ). Neutral atoms have the same number of electrons and protons. Atoms of an element that contain different numbers of neutrons are called isotopes. WebApr 5, 2024 · atomic model, in physics, a model used to describe the structure and makeup of an atom. Atomic models have gone through many changes over time, evolving as necessary to fit experimental data.
